SCREENING OF TRICHOTHECENE -PRODUCing FUSARIUM CULMORUM ISOLATES FROM WHEAT FARMS OF WEST AZARBAYJAN PROVINCE ACCORDING TO THE TRI13 GENE

Abstract
Fusarium culmorum which is considered as the causal agent of Fusarium head blight, can produce deoxynivalenol (DON), nivalenol (NIV) and their acetylated derivatives. This study has been assessed in order to detect the Tri13 gene using primer pairs Tri13DONR/Tri13F and Tri13R/Tri13NIVF, to investigate the potential of F. culmorum isolates in the production of DON and NIV in West Azarbayjan province, Iran. In this study, 98 F. culmorum isolates were obtained from Urmia, Khoy, Miandoab, Maku, Tekab and Mahabad regions. For this purpose, F. culmorum isolates were identified based on the morphological characteristics as well as specific primer pairs, C51F/C51R. Production of DON and NIV were detected in these isolates according to Tri13 gene. Results showed that 60.2 percent of isolates have the potential to produce DON and 39.8 percent of isolates have ability to produce NIV.
